The steps to preparing for an internal audit are 1) initial audit planning, 2) involve risk and process subject matter experts, 3) frameworks for internal audit processes, 4) initial document request list, 5) preparing for a planning meeting with business stakeholders, 6) preparing the audit program, and 7) audit program and planning review.
